Question ntl and front page extensions

Can anyone tell me if ntl supports front page extensions?

I'd like to include a form onto a website that I've created, but I can't seem to get any info sent back to me. I've set the hyperlink on the submit button to my email addy.

NTL provides only HTML support for web pages. (and javascript, but that's a browser thing)

One option, pay for some hosting, see Matt D's post, or if you don't have a need for paid hosting you can use a free 3rd party form processor.
I've used the service at http://www.response-o-matic.com/ in the past, you basically point your form to their script. Info on the site.
